No More Short Skirts For Elizabeth Hurley?

Darpan News Desk IANS, 04 Apr, 2015 03:02 PM
  • No More Short Skirts For Elizabeth Hurley?
Actress Elizabeth Hurley says she wears jeans nearly every day because her days of wearing short skirts are "long gone".
 
The 49-year-old actress admits she no longer feels comfortable in more revealing garments, reports femalefirst.co.uk.
 
"I wear jeans pretty much every day. I love short skirts and shorts but those days are long gone for me," she told Hello! Magazine.
 
The "Royals" actress, who has 13-year-old son Damian with former boyfriend Steve Bing, loves ending the day with a relaxing bath and if she is feeling especially indulgent, she devotes entire evenings to her beauty regime.
 
She said: "Wherever I am in the world. I always end my day immersed in a deep bath full of Jo Malone oil.
 
"(On my dream day), I'd stay in and do a whole home beauty evening. Occasionally I'll put on a hair mask, anoint myself with oil and lie on a towel for a few hours reading a book. Bliss!"
